What is recorded here

Earthwork complex described in 1943 as following; 'Complex of 2 Earthworks of Type A and 3 Ring-barrows. No. I. This is the larger of the Type A structures and consists of a low circular platform surrounded by a fosse. Outside this there was a bank which now remains on the east side of the monument for about one-third of its circuit. The maximum height of the platform over field level is 3' [0.9m] and the monument had an original overall diameter of 200' [61m] approximately' (O'Kelly 1942-3, 172). Outline of monument visible today on Digital Globe aerial photograph. Compiled by: Caimin O'Brien Date of upload: 24 February 2020
